June 18 1:59 PM PT2:59 PM MT3:59 PM CT4:59 PM ET16:59 ET20:59 GMT4:59 CST1:59 PM MST3:59 PM EST4:29 PM VEN0:59 UAE (+1)3:59 PM CT-Cecil won for the first time since July 29 and the Toronto Blue Jays beat the Philadelphia Phillies 6-2 to complete a three-game sweep.
Analysis: Starting for the first time this season after being promoted from Triple-A Las Vegas last week, the left-handed Cecil (1-0) allowed two runs and five hits in five innings. He walked one and struck out five. Cecil went 4-11 in 20 starts last season, then struggled with command and velocity this spring after losing more than 30 pounds in offseason conditioning. He was demoted to Double-A on the final day of spring training, one day after a rough outing against Detroit.
Apr. 3 11:19 AM PT12:19 PM MT1:19 PM CT2:19 PM ET14:19 ET18:19 GMT2:19 CST11:19 AM MST1:19 PM EST1:49 PM VEN22:19 UAE1:19 PM CT-The Toronto Blue Jays have demoted Cecil, a day after his latest rough outing at spring training.
Analysis: Cecil was sent down to Double-A New Hampshire on Tuesday. Righty Roberto Coello was promoted from the minors to be part of Toronto's rotation. The Blue Jays said righty Kyle Drabek had the fifth starting spot. Left-hander Aaron Laffey was moved to Triple-A Las Vegas. Cecil was tagged for nine runs in the first two innings Monday against Detroit. Cecil had a 6.48 ERA in exhibitions this year and was 4-11 with a 4.73 ERA last season.
